A long-running home-area archive

Subic Bay, Olongapo and the surrounding Freeport make up one of the deepest parts of the 360 Tour archive because they have been filmed repeatedly over many years. That makes the collection useful not only as travel footage but also as a record of roads, businesses, attractions and everyday routes at different points in time.

Road layouts and traffic patterns have changed during the life of the archive. More recent local changes include additional one-way routing on some roads and a newer bridge connection between the Freeport and Olongapo, both of which can change how a present-day trip compares with older footage. Older videos should therefore be treated as a view of the place on the recorded date, not as turn-by-turn current navigation.

First-hand Insta360 X4 experience

The X4 replaced an aging Insta360 ONE X2 as part of a normal two- to three-year gear upgrade cycle. The reasons were practical as well as technical: batteries age quickly in a hot climate, while the X4 brought larger sensors, higher resolution, Active HDR and more AI-assisted features.

Although 8K was tested, 5.7K Active HDR became the more useful everyday mode. In practice, the extra dynamic range and low-light improvement mattered more than repeatedly producing very large 8K files that YouTube would often deliver to viewers at a lower effective quality after processing.
